Homes in Ogden and surrounding communities experience foundation and concrete challenges caused by soil conditions, moisture fluctuations, and natural settlement over time. These issues often show up as cracked walls, sloping floors, sticking doors, or sinking driveways and sidewalks.

Cracks and open joints in concrete allow moisture to enter and weaken the soil below. At the show, we’ll explain how professional crack repair and joint sealing can help protect concrete surfaces and reduce the risk of future settlement.
